• Dragon Boat Festival is celebrated on May 5 of the lunar calendar. (Georgian Calendar – June)
• The Dragon Boat Festival is also known as "Double Fifth Day".
June 9, 2016(Lunar calendar - May 5)
On this day, activities people often do1. Eating (and preparing) zongzi, 吃粽子2. Drinking realgar wine, and 雄黃酒3. Racing dragon boats. 划龍舟
Story of Qu Yuan • Commemorates the death of the poet
and minister Qu Yuan (340–278 BC) of the ancient state of Chu, who committed suicide by drowning himself in the MiLuo River.
• The boat races were inspired by the villager's valiant attempts to rescue Qu Yuan from the Mi-luo river.
• The village people threw the rice ball into the river to prevent the fishes eating Qu Yuan’s body.
Dragon Boat Race赛龙舟• Competing teams drive their colorful dragon
boats forward to the rhythm of beating drums. • Races can have any number of boats competing, with the
winner being the first team to grab a flag at the end of the course

Rice Dumpling - Zongzi
• Traditional food for the Dragon Boat Festival
• Zongzi consists of rice dumplings filled with meat, peanut, egg, beans, dates, sweet potatoes, walnuts, mushrooms, or a combination of both.
• Steamed and wrapped in bamboo/corn leaves. 粽子

Breaking the evil spirits
• Hanging up icons of Zhong Kui (a mythic guardian figure) 貼鍾馗像驅瘟疫、瘟神
• Hanging mugwort and calamus 懸香草(菖蒲、艾草等)• Tie colorful strings on the arms 纏五彩絲線• Wearing perfumed medicine bags佩香囊
12:00 PMStanding Eggs
“If you can balance an egg on it’s end at exactly 12:00pm it is believed that you will have good luck for the rest of the year.“
